Account Recovery — Pagewright Static Builds

If a customer loses access to their Pagewright dashboard, incremental rebuilds of their static site will continue from the last known-good deploy, so no content is lost during recovery. Confirm the customer's last rebuild timestamp in the Orlin console, then initiate the recovery flow from the admin panel. Do not trigger a full rebuild until access is restored. Unlocking the recovery flow requires the passphrase below.

recovery phrase for yadup-taguf: wenael-quenox-kelix

Subject: Key rotation ahead of the user-module split

Hi Darla,

As part of carving the user module out of the Ostrel monolith into the new Fennwick identity service, we are rotating all credentials that touched the legacy auth tables. Old keys stop working at Friday's cutover, so please update the release pipeline configuration before then. The replacement key for the staging identity endpoint is included below.

gateway credential: kto23_LX9A4ys6i4nzHtpOLNLodKK

**Vendor note: Inkmill markdown pipeline**

Rendering for Parchway docs is outsourced to Inkmill under an annual contract, renewing each March. They handle sanitization and PDF export; we own the upload queue. SLA: 4-hour response on rendering failures. Escalate only after two failed retries. Their support desk is reachable at the address below.

billing contact of hahaf-baguf = zorael.tammir.jorius@sivrelhq.internal

Internal Memo — Finance Team

Heads up: the sales-commission scheme gets an overhaul from Q2. Flat 6% goes away; we're moving to tiered rates tied to margin, not revenue. Yes, the payout model in Ledgerbird needs rebuilding — Priya's team owns that. Draft rate tables arrive Wednesday; please sanity-check before they go to the sales floor. Why we're doing this now is explained here.

management briefing: Project Ulavan slips by two quarters because of the staffing delay.

**Ticket LNT-412: sqllint failing with connection errors**

New folks keep hitting this: the `sqllint` pre-commit hook validates SQL files against a live schema, so it needs database access. If you see "connection refused," the linter is pointing at the wrong host. Fix is to export the lint database target in your shell profile, using the connection string below.

database URL for tajog-bajeg: mysql://soreth_svc:OzsCjhu@db-6997.nelvrostack.internal:5432/kelax